Ingredients
For the Pork Chops and Gravy:
- 4 bone-in or boneless pork chops
- 1 cup all-purpose flour (for dredging and optional roux)
- ¼ cup olive oil (or any cooking oil of choice)
- 2 large green peppers, sliced
- 1 large onion, sliced
- 2 packets brown gravy mix (optional alternative to homemade gravy)
- 1 cup water (for homemade roux or per gravy mix instructions)
For the Rice:
- 2 cups long-grain white rice
- 2 cups water
Seasonings:
- 2 tsp salt
- 1 tsp black pepper
- 1 tsp granulated garlic (optional but highly recommended)
Optional Garnish:
- Hot sauce (to take the dish to the next level)
Instructions
Step 1: Cook the Rice
- Bring 2 cups of water to a boil in a medium pot.
- Add a pinch of salt, then stir in the rice.
- Cover, reduce heat to low, and simmer for 18-20 minutes, or until the rice is tender and the water is fully absorbed.
Step 2: Prepare the Pork Chops
- Season the pork chops on both sides with salt, pepper, and granulated garlic.
- Dredge the pork chops in flour, shaking off any excess.
Step 3: Sear the Pork Chops
- Heat the olive oil in a large cast-iron skillet over medium-high heat.
- Add the pork chops and brown for 3-4 minutes per side until golden. Remove and set aside.
Step 4: Make the Gravy
Option 1: Homemade Roux
- In the same skillet, whisk 2-3 tablespoons of the leftover flour into the remaining oil. Cook over medium heat, stirring constantly, until the roux is golden brown (about 2-3 minutes).
- Gradually whisk in 1 cup of water until smooth, creating a rich gravy.
Option 2: Gravy Mix
- Prepare the gravy according to the packet instructions, using 2 cups of water.
Step 5: Combine and Simmer
- Add the sliced green peppers and onions to the skillet with the gravy. Stir to combine.
- Nestle the pork chops back into the skillet, covering them with the gravy and vegetables.
- Reduce the heat to low, cover, and let everything simmer for at least 30 minutes. This will tenderize the pork chops and meld the flavors.
Step 6: Serve
- Scoop a serving of rice onto each plate.
- Place a pork chop on top, then ladle the gravy and vegetables over the rice and pork chop.
- Optional: Add a few dashes of hot sauce for extra flavor.
Tips for Success
- Don’t Skip the Sear: Browning the pork chops adds deep flavor to the dish.
- Customize the Gravy: Add a splash of Worcestershire sauce or a teaspoon of Dijon mustard for an extra layer of flavor.
- Make It a Meal: Serve with a side of greens or cornbread for a complete Southern-inspired dinner. Or make a sammie with a side of rice.
